Output 4e250369f471b401ac4f5d6fd8e77158d22ae547f94e7524356db549bae183f6:0

value
624292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2444a8537290adcda67234bf40d94f1baa3ac86a OP_EQUAL
address
34znVriZc4MhFuMwjgqfVi5P2WbPc364zB
transaction
4e250369f471b401ac4f5d6fd8e77158d22ae547f94e7524356db549bae183f6
spent
true